Party Potato Appetizers

New potatoes are young with thin skins so they do not need to be peeled. You can top these little appetizers with diced red onions, parsley, chives, diced bell peppers, bacon bits, shredded cheese or spigs of fresh herbs such as dill weed. Combinations of toppings are great too. Show more

Directions

  1. Heat 1 inch water to boiling in a medium sauce pan.
  2. Add potatoes; cover and heat to boiling; reduce heat and simmer 20 to 25 minutes or until tender; drain and cool 30 minutes to an hour.
  3. Cut potatoes in half and place on a serving tray cut side up (cut a thin slice from the bottom if necessary to help them stand upright).
  4. Top each potato half with 1 teaspoon sour cream; garnish as desired.
  5. Cover and chill until serving.
